Transaction d1068dba75cb6c0623e50fa428e9a28b1fcc3b4d7f40065f942f2800899395bc
1 Input
1 Output
-
d1068dba75cb6c0623e50fa428e9a28b1fcc3b4d7f40065f942f2800899395bc:0
- value
- 635187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d24563963d43103736f02bbbd389ac1e6a432b9 OP_EQUAL
- address
- 3MrJnfV2Ja5jvHkJqAcHnY3qshAuKQGSn8